Overview
Dame Vanessa Redgrave (born 30 January 1937) is an English actress and activist. In a career spanning over six decades, her accolades include an Academy Award, a Tony Award, two Primetime Emmy Awards, a Volpi Cup and an Olivier Award, making her one of the few performers to achieve the Triple Crown of Acting.

Awards & achievements
- Commander of the Order of the British Empire
- 1999 Donostia Award
- 1978 Academy Award for Best Supporting Actress
- 2003 Tony Award for Best Actress in a Play
- Commandeur des Arts et des Lettres
- 1978 Golden Globe Award for Best Supporting Actress – Motion Picture
- 1981 Primetime Emmy Award for Outstanding Lead Actress in a Miniseries or a Movie
- 2000 Primetime Emmy Award for Outstanding Supporting Actress in a Miniseries or a Movie
